From Untiereds to Ubers

The unfortunate thing about there being over 800 Pokémon in existence is that some are bound to be left in the dust. For Smogon, these neglected Pokémon fall into the "Untiered" category, due to their lack of unique or strong traits that make a Pokémon viable. Many Pet Mods are created with the sole purpose of buffing those Untiered Pokémon, and others like them, so that they can be viable in the higher tiers. This begs the question, though: what would happen if we buffed these Pokémon so much that they could even do battle with the gods of Pokémon?

Well, welcome to From Untiereds to Ubers, where we aim to do just that! The idea of this Pet Mod is to, as the name suggests, take completely unviable mons and give them so many new tools that they would be banned to, or at least be viable in, Ubers. Ideally, buffs should be less focused on crazy stat increases, and more about exploring unique ways of making a Pokémon good enough to compete among the best of their kind, whether that be through expanded movepools or access to new or underutilized Abilities and type combinations.

Rules
  • Have fun with your submissions! A lot of Pet Mods are designed around OU, and thusly require some restraint for their submissions. Not here! While there will be a couple limits (as listed below), remember that the Ubers tier is filled with ridiculously overpowered Pokémon, so go ahead and indulge in whatever brokenness you desire.
  • With each slate, you can submit up to three Pokémon. These may be any of the Pokémon in the list above, as long as they haven't been a winning submission yet.
  • During the voting phase, you may vote for up to five submissions. You may self-vote, but only once per slate.
  • Only one custom Move or Ability per submission.The custom Moves and Abilities should also be a clone of an existing Move/Ability, unless you provide a code for them.
    • Custom Abilities must not be the effects of two or more abilities combined. This would effectively give the Pokémon two abilities, which isn't a very creative or fun way of making a Pokémon broken. Keep any custom Abilities actually custom.
  • As far as the more busted abilities are concerned, I will establish some limits now:
    • I will allow Delta Stream, but not Desolate Land and Primordial Sea. From my experience with Ubers, it's clear that the latter two are too broken to just get thrown on any Pokémon, and I don't want this Pet Mod to become overrun by the weather wars. However, Delta Stream could make for interesting submissions considering its current absence in Ubers, and its effect of canceling Primal weather will be invaluable to checking the Primals.
    • If using any clones of Huge Power, I am establishing a limit of 70 to any affected base attacking stat. As both Mega Mawile and Medicham have shown us, these abilities have the potential to be way too broken without some sort of limit.
    • Parental Bond is allowed, but I would appreciate some flavor reasoning if used.
    • Shadow Tag and Arena Trap are not allowed. Both Dugtrio and Gothitelle have shown how trapping is generally uncompetitive and not fun.
    • Water Bubble is allowed with a limit of 80 on both base attacking stats.
    • Fur Coat and any clones have a limit of 90 on any affected base defending stat.
    • Fluffy and any clones have a limit of 100 on any affected base defending stat (i.e. Def for contact moves and SpD for non-contact moves)
    • Wonder Guard is banned. No ifs, ands, or buts about it (except on Shedinja).
Of course, submission rules are subject to change. I'm reasonable, so if you guys disagree and want one of these abilities unbanned or a limit lifted, I will hear you out. Just remember, we're designing for Ubers, not Anything Goes.

Dewgong
Type: Water / Ice
Stats: 90 / 82 / 82 / 115 / 119 / 112 | 600 BST
Abilities: Thick Fat / Hydration | Adaptability (HA)
Moveset: +Freeze Dry, +Focus Blast, +Calm Mind, +U-turn
Reasoning: Water and Ice are collectively only resisted by Water types, and STAB Freeze Dry deals with most of those very well, making Water / Ice a godly offensive type for Ubers. Thanks to Adaptability it hits as hard as Kyurem-W and can OHKO common pokemon like Yveltal, Arceus Ground, Mega Salamence, and Giratina-O with a +1 boost or Specs; it also 2HKOes most sets of the primals and Necrozma-DM with no boost. It can easily run Specs or Calm Mind sets, with a speed tier above most Ubers and decent SpD.


Furret
Type: Normal / Ground
Stats: 120 / 115 / 85 / 70 / 75 / 135 | 600 BST
Abilities: Moxie / Keen Eye | Skill Link (HA)
Moveset: +Earthquake, +Tail Slap, +Rock Blast, +Bone Rush,
Reasoning: Furret is a fast offensive pivot with a decently good STAB combo, if somewhat low power for Ubers. Skill Link is nice for Sash Deoxys / Marshadow, and Lugia's multiscale. 135 is a great speed tier, ahead of Mewtwo-X, Ultra Necrozma, and Skymin. Coil pairs well with its stats and various inaccurate multi-hit moves.

W H I S C A S H M O N E Y
Typing: Water / Ground
Ability: Simple / Oblivious | HA: Wonder Skin
Stats: 130 HP / 148 Atk / 83 Def / 76 SpA / 91 SpD / 80 Spe
BST: 608
New Moves: +Slack Off +Swords Dance
Competitive Niche: Whiscash combines one of the best defensive typings in the metagame with good bulk to be.....one of the most threatening sweepers in the metagame? Whiscash has the bulk to set up on threats like Mega Gengar and then proceed to then tear apart teams with its access to Simple Dragon Dance. With this combo, it can quicky run through offensively inclined teams, or it can opt for Swords Dance to do a number to defensive ones. Its held back by being unable to fully handle defensive behemoths such as Lugia and Giratina, while also being hilariously counterswept by Choice Scarf Marshadow even at +2. Even with these flaws, Whiscash can prove to be a menace to build against.

In my opinion, Slaking is Ubers already with just Intimidate, it doesn't need any stat shuffling or new moves (although U-Turn is pretty useful). Intimidate with 150/100 bulk is fantastic physically, even unboosted, and it has good offensive presence already. Putting a Choice Band on this thing would make it break through walls easily:
252 Atk Choice Band Slaking Return vs. 252 HP / 64 Def Arceus-Water: 237-279 (53.3 - 62.8%) -- guaranteed 2HKO
252 Atk Choice Band Slaking Return vs. 252 HP / 176+ Def Yveltal: 232-274 (50.8 - 60%) -- guaranteed 2HKO
252 Atk Choice Band Slaking Return vs. 252 HP / 56+ Def Groudon: 190-225 (47 - 55.6%) -- guaranteed 2HKO after Stealth Rock

Pokémon: Bastiodon
Typing: Steel
Abilities: Sturdy / Filter / Bulletproof
Stats: 117 HP / 82 Atk / 168 Def / 30 SpA / 156 SpD / 27 Spe | 580 BST
New Moves: Anchor Shot, Gyro Ball, King's Shield, Knock Off, Parting Shot, Slack Off, Spikes
Competitive (niche in Ubers): Say hello to what might be the best Xerneas counter in the whole game. Thanks to its absurd bulk, Xerneas can't make a dent in this walking shield due to its great defenses and awesome defensive abilities that can mitigate any coverage it has. Bulletproof ensures not even Focus Blast variants of Xern can break past it, while Filter can reduce damage from all its super effective coverage. In addition to that, it also can trap passive foes with Anchor Shot and wear them down with the combination of Slack Off, King's Shield, and Toxic. Other utility options include Knock Off to remove pesky Eviolites from Chansey, Parting Shot to act as a bulky pivot, and Spikes to gain chip damage on foes. However, its very low offenses and vulnerability to Primal Groudon should be able to keep this thing in check.
